Forum » Izdelava spletišč » 3 divi v divu in float
3 divi v divu in float
alexa-lol ::
hej imam problem...imam 3 dive v divu Meni in sicer div robl, robnot, robd. Kako naj naštimam, da mi padejo vsi v div Meni. Robd in robl sta siroka 1px, robnot ima pa backgorund-repeat:repeat-x;
A razumete kaj mislim al prilimam CSS in HTML kodo?
A razumete kaj mislim al prilimam CSS in HTML kodo?
alexa-lol ::
ok..da ne bom kompliciral
CSS koda je
#meni {
height: 24px;
width: 100%;
}
#robl {
width:1px;
height:24px;
background:url(rob4.gif);
background-position: left bottom;
background-repeat:no-repeat;
}
#robnot {
height:24px;
background:url(robnot4.gif);
background-position: right top;
background-repeat:repeat-x;
}
#robd {
width:1px;
height:24px;
background:url(rob4.gif);
background-position: left bottom;
background-repeat:no-repeat;
}
HTML pa
kako naj nastimam floate?
CSS koda je
#meni {
height: 24px;
width: 100%;
}
#robl {
width:1px;
height:24px;
background:url(rob4.gif);
background-position: left bottom;
background-repeat:no-repeat;
}
#robnot {
height:24px;
background:url(robnot4.gif);
background-position: right top;
background-repeat:repeat-x;
}
#robd {
width:1px;
height:24px;
background:url(rob4.gif);
background-position: left bottom;
background-repeat:no-repeat;
}
HTML pa
<div id="meni"> <div id="robl"></div> <div id="robnot"></div> <div id="robd"></div> </div>
kako naj nastimam floate?
Binji ::
float:left za 3 notranje dive? Ali pa right.. kar ti bolj pase. Po teh divih pa se element, ki ima nastavljeno clear:both
Kdor ne navija ni Slovenc, hej, hej, hej!
Binji ::
recimo [br class='clear' /], kjer je stil:
.clear{
clear:both;
}
kr1frik: dela ze, ampak ti dela hude probleme z ostalim layoutom, ce tega nimas definiranega po vsakem elementu, ki je floatan.
.clear{
clear:both;
}
kr1frik: dela ze, ampak ti dela hude probleme z ostalim layoutom, ce tega nimas definiranega po vsakem elementu, ki je floatan.
Kdor ne navija ni Slovenc, hej, hej, hej!
alexa-lol ::
ok situacija je taka
to s kodo
ter CSS kodo
gledajte dol od tistega modrega headerja....tam umes pride tale meni
to s kodo
<div id="meni"> <div id="robl"></div> <div id="robnot"></div> <div id="robd"></div> </div> <br id="clear" />
ter CSS kodo
#meni {
height: 24px;
width: 100%;
}
#robl {
width:1px;
height:24px;
background:url(rob4.gif);
background-position: left bottom;
background-repeat:no-repeat;
float:left;
}
#robnot {
height:24px;
background:url(robnot4.gif);
background-position: right top;
background-repeat:repeat-x;
float:left;
}
#robd {
width:1px;
height:24px;
background:url(rob4.gif);
background-position: left bottom;
background-repeat:no-repeat;
float:left;
}
#clear {
clear:both;
}
gledajte dol od tistega modrega headerja....tam umes pride tale meni
Zgodovina sprememb…
- spremenil: alexa-lol ()
alexa-lol ::
omg...jaz ne vem kaj je te kodi....zdaj sem naredil en suh primer in sem nasel primer....moti ga tistih 100% pri enem od kvadratkov...
A bi se dal kako prepričat CSS, da tistih 100% ne pomeni globalno ampak glede na to koliko prostora ostane med okvirckoma ena in tri
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d">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1"> <link rel="stylesheet" type="text/css" href="test.css"> <title>Untitled Document</title> </head> <body> <div id="meni"> <div id="ena"></div> <div id="dva"></div> <div id="tri"></div> </div> </body> </html>
#meni {
border: 2px solid black;
width:888px;
height:500px;
max-width:888px;
}
#ena {
border: 2px solid red;
width:250px;
height:450px;
float:left;
}
#dva {
border: 2px solid green;
width:100%;
height:450px;
float:left;
}
#tri {
border: 2px solid blue;
width:250px;
height:450px;
float:left;
}
A bi se dal kako prepričat CSS, da tistih 100% ne pomeni globalno ampak glede na to koliko prostora ostane med okvirckoma ena in tri
Binji ::
Zakaj zaboga sploh rabis dive siroke 1px? Ti mocno priporocam, da si pogledas najprej kak tutorial o pozicioniranju, pa paddingih, marginih, potem pa se menimo naprej.
Kdor ne navija ni Slovenc, hej, hej, hej!
alexa-lol ::
to je ubistvu rob, ki je malo temnejši :)..vem kako bom naredil...ne bom jih pozicioniral v vodoravni črti ampak v navpični :)
evo dela ko puška... :)
evo dela ko puška... :)
Zgodovina sprememb…
- spremenil: alexa-lol ()
alexa-lol ::
ok vglavnem..robova sem zbrisu in dela :)
zdaj mam pa problem s postavitvijo kazala...margin left lepo nastimam, ko pa hočem nastaviti margin top mi pa ne dela več...
no v glavnem zdaj bi rad, da se mi okvircek kazalo pomakne za 10 pixlov dol
ok nasel rsitev..v kazalo v CSS kodi damo margin-top:15px;
zdaj mam pa problem s postavitvijo kazala...margin left lepo nastimam, ko pa hočem nastaviti margin top mi pa ne dela več...
<div id="glavni"> <div id="vsebina"></div> <div id="kazalo"><div> </div>
#glavni {
border:2px solid red;
width:944px;
height:476px;
margin: 0 auto;
}
#vsebina {
border:2px solid black;
width:724px;
height:476px;
float:left;
}
#kazalo {
border:2px solid blue;
width:180px;
height:400px;
margin: 20 left;
}
no v glavnem zdaj bi rad, da se mi okvircek kazalo pomakne za 10 pixlov dol
ok nasel rsitev..v kazalo v CSS kodi damo margin-top:15px;
Zgodovina sprememb…
- spremenil: alexa-lol ()
Vredno ogleda ...
| Tema | Ogledi | Zadnje sporočilo | |
|---|---|---|---|
| Tema | Ogledi | Zadnje sporočilo | |
| ! | Vse, kar ste si želeli vprašati o CSS, pa si niste upali. (strani: 1 2 3 4 … 23 24 25 26 )Oddelek: Izdelava spletišč | 368821 (27958) | sunniegoldie |
| » | Prikaz strani na različni resoluciji-JoomlaOddelek: Izdelava spletišč | 2159 (1887) | kr?en |
| » | Ocena? Kako bi dodal podstrani?Oddelek: Pomoč in nasveti | 1033 (898) | shadeX |
| » | Kontaknti obrazec - potrebujem pomočOddelek: Programiranje | 1269 (991) | cobrica |
| » | Podrta oblika straniOddelek: Izdelava spletišč | 1508 (1187) | echoman |
